How to treat cervical hypertrophy?

Cervical hypertrophy is usually caused by cervical injury, cervicitis, cervical cysts, etc., and generally requires medication and surgical treatment.

1. Cervical injury:

If the cervix is ​​damaged, it is likely to cause redness, swelling and pain in the cervix, so the swelling may appear as hypertrophy. If the damage is serious, it can be treated with cervical repair surgery, and the local symptoms will generally disappear after treatment.

2. Cervicitis:

It is mainly due to bacterial infection, which can cause abdominal pain and vaginal bleeding symptoms. It can also be stimulated by local inflammation, leading to inflammation and hypertrophy of cervical tissue. You need to follow the doctor's advice and take ibuprofen sustained-release tablets, levofloxacin hydrochloride tablets, amoxicillin capsules and other drugs for treatment. These drugs can usually play an anti-inflammatory and bactericidal role.

3. Cervical cyst:

It is usually caused by long-term stimulation of local inflammation, which will cause contact pain and contact bleeding. Due to the cystic space-occupying lesions, local abnormal swelling and hypertrophy can be treated by cystectomy.

In addition to the above reasons, there may also be congenital genetic reasons. During the treatment of the disease, try to stay in bed and rest, and don't be too tired.
